Collaborations in funded teams are essential for understanding funded research and funding policies, although of high interest, are still not fully understood. This study aims to investigate directed collaboration patterns from the perspective of the knowledge flow, which is measured based on the academic age. To this end, we proposed a project-based team identification approach, which gives particular attention to funded teams. The method is applicable to other funding systems. Based on identified scientific teams, we detected recurring and significant subgraph patterns, known as network motifs, and under-represented patterns, known as anti-motifs. We found commonly occurred motifs and anti-motifs are remarkably characterized by different structures matching certain functions in knowledge exchanges. Collaboration patterns represented by motifs favor hierarchical structures, supporting intensive interactions across academic generations. Anti-motifs are more likely to show chain-like structures, hindering potentially various knowledge activities, and are thus seldom found in real collaboration networks. These findings provide new insights into the understanding of funded collaborations and also the funding system. Meanwhile, our findings are helpful for researchers, the public and policymakers to gain knowledge on research(ers) evolution, particularly in terms of primordial collaboration patterns.  相似文献

[目的/意义]为了深入了解科研众筹平台中的项目情况,本文对科研众筹项目的基本特征、研究主题和不同类型科研众筹项目的属性对比进行研究。[研究设计/方法]首先对科研众筹的起源、价值和运作模式进行了梳理;随后爬取了科研众筹平台Experiment的项目信息,并对该平台中科研项目的发起者、背书者、项目记录、所属学科、资助情况等进行特征描述;基于LDA模型对科研众筹项目主题进一步细化,并对不同资金筹集和不同主题分类情况下的科研众筹项目的属性差异进行比较分析。[结论/发现]科研众筹主题主要集中在生物学和生态学两个领域,不同资金筹集达成情况的科研众筹项目在项目背书者数量、信息记录次数和讨论次数上具有显著差异;不同主题的科研众筹项目在其讨论次数上具有显著差异。同时,是否提供视频和是否参与资助挑战在不同资金筹集达成情况和不同主题的科研众筹项目上均具有显著差异。[创新/价值]深入分析了科研众筹平台中项目主题及属性对比情况,对科研众筹平台优化信息审核机制、社交机制和信息展示机制具有一定的参考价值。  相似文献

[目的/意义]从用户动机视角对Altmetrics指标的本质和价值进行分析,使Altmetrics的应用更为科学合理。[研究设计/方法]首先对相关文献中的动机进行组织提炼与规范化表述。在此基础上引入用户行为理论解释和分析用户动机体现的指标价值。再选取Twitter提及量指标,使用内容分析法进行案例研究。[结论/发现]提炼出19种用户动机,其中有6种动机会降低指标应用价值。[创新/价值]探索Altmetrics数据的产生机制,在一定程度上回答了Altmetrics指标可用性问题。  相似文献

Five hundred million tweets are posted daily, making Twitter a major social media platform from which topical information on events can be extracted. These events are represented by three main dimensions: time, location and entity-related information. The focus of this paper is location, which is an essential dimension for geo-spatial applications, either when helping rescue operations during a disaster or when used for contextual recommendations. While the first type of application needs high recall, the second is more precision-oriented. This paper studies the recall/precision trade-off, combining different methods to extract locations. In the context of short posts, applying tools that have been developed for natural language is not sufficient given the nature of tweets which are generally too short to be linguistically correct. Also bearing in mind the high number of posts that need to be handled, we hypothesize that predicting whether a post contains a location or not could make the location extractors more focused and thus more effective. We introduce a model to predict whether a tweet contains a location or not and show that location prediction is a useful pre-processing step for location extraction. We define a number of new tweet features and we conduct an intensive evaluation. Our findings are that (1) combining existing location extraction tools is effective for precision-oriented or recall-oriented results, (2) enriching tweet representation is effective for predicting whether a tweet contains a location or not, (3) words appearing in a geography gazetteer and the occurrence of a preposition just before a proper noun are the two most important features for predicting the occurrence of a location in tweets, and (4) the accuracy of location extraction improves when it is possible to predict that there is a location in a tweet.  相似文献

The present paper thoroughly examines how one can effectively bridge in-school and out-of-school learning. The first part discusses the difficulty in defining out-of-school learning. It proposes to distinguish three types of learning: formal, informal, and non-formal. The second part raises the question of whether out-of-school learning should be dealt with in the in-school system, in view of the fact that we experience informal learning anyway as well as considering the disadvantages and difficulties teachers are confronted with when planning and carrying out scientific fieldtrips. The voices of the teachers, the students, and the non-formal institution staff are heard to provide insights into the problem. The third part discusses the cognitive and affective aspects of non-formal learning. The fourth part presents some models explaining scientific fieldtrip learning and based on those models, suggests a novel explanation. The fifth part offers some recommendations of how to bridge in and out-of-school learning. The paper closes with some practical ideas as to how one can bring the theory described in the paper into practice. It is hoped that this paper will provide educators with an insight so that they will be able to fully exploit the great potential that scientific field trips may offer. 英才是创新人才中最具创新能力的群体。科学有效的英才选拔是实施英才教育与提升我国自主创新能力的前提。尽管我国在创新人才选拔方面已有长期探索,但这一群体的选拔和培养仍有待完善。俄罗斯是世界上建立英才教育体系的先驱之一,其顶尖高校对创新人才的选拔以附属于高校的专业教学科研中心为基础。专业教学科研中心在半个多世纪的英才选拔实践中形成了诸多特色做法:与顶尖大学和国家科学院协调联动,重视考察和培养学生志趣,强调扎实的基础知识与创新能力,建立完善的管理与运行机制。  相似文献

本文分析了基于Web的科学交流系统的基本组成和基于Web的科学交流的基本过程,讨论了网络交流作为科学交流模式的必要前提及网络交流对传统交流角色的冲击,认为整个科学交流体系正在经历着一场深刻的社会变革,而实现网上科学交流的社会化和普遍化需要全社会做出不懈的努力.  相似文献
